本文目录导读:
随着信息技术的高速发展,虚拟化技术逐渐成为现代数据中心的核心技术之一,虚拟化软件作为实现虚拟化的关键工具,能够在服务器上实现资源的灵活分配和高效利用,本文将从虚拟化软件的工作原理、应用场景以及影响等方面进行深入探讨。
虚拟化软件的工作原理
1、虚拟化技术概述
虚拟化技术是一种将物理资源(如CPU、内存、存储等)转化为虚拟资源的技术,通过虚拟化软件,可以将一台物理服务器分割成多个虚拟机(VM),每个虚拟机都拥有独立的操作系统和资源,从而实现多任务并行处理。
2、虚拟化软件的工作原理
图片来源于网络,如有侵权联系删除
虚拟化软件通过以下步骤实现服务器虚拟化:
(1)资源抽象:将物理服务器上的硬件资源(如CPU、内存、存储等)抽象为虚拟资源,以便于管理和分配。
(2)资源隔离:为每个虚拟机分配独立的资源,确保虚拟机之间相互隔离,避免资源争抢和冲突。
(3)资源调度:根据虚拟机的需求动态调整资源分配,实现资源的高效利用。
(4)虚拟化驱动程序:在物理服务器上安装虚拟化驱动程序,负责与虚拟机进行交互,提供必要的硬件支持。
虚拟化软件的应用场景
1、服务器整合与优化
虚拟化技术可以将多台物理服务器整合为一台虚拟服务器,提高资源利用率,降低硬件成本,虚拟化软件可以根据业务需求动态调整资源分配,实现服务器性能的优化。
2、业务连续性与灾难恢复
图片来源于网络,如有侵权联系删除
虚拟化软件可以将业务系统部署在多个虚拟机上,实现业务的负载均衡和高可用性,在发生故障时,可以快速切换至备用虚拟机,确保业务连续性。
3、灵活部署与扩展
虚拟化软件支持快速创建、迁移和扩展虚拟机,满足企业业务快速发展的需求,虚拟化软件还支持跨平台部署,方便企业进行IT基础设施的升级和迁移。
4、研发与测试
虚拟化软件可以创建多个虚拟机,用于研发和测试环境,降低研发成本,提高测试效率。
虚拟化软件的影响
1、资源利用率提高
虚拟化技术可以将物理服务器上的资源利用率提高数倍,降低硬件成本。
2、灵活性增强
图片来源于网络,如有侵权联系删除
虚拟化软件可以提高企业IT基础设施的灵活性,满足业务快速发展的需求。
3、稳定性提高
虚拟化软件可以将业务系统部署在多个虚拟机上,实现负载均衡和高可用性,提高系统稳定性。
4、管理效率提升
虚拟化软件简化了IT基础设施的管理,提高管理效率。
虚拟化软件在服务器上的应用,为企业带来了诸多优势,随着虚拟化技术的不断发展,虚拟化软件将在未来数据中心中发挥越来越重要的作用。
标签: #虚拟化软件如何作用于服务器
评论列表